Nature-Inspired Principles for Sustainable Process Design in Chemical Engineeringidentified in natural systems allow to avoid secondary eco-problems and proposes to apply these principles for sustainable design in chemical process engineering. The research work critically examines how this approach differs from the biomimetics, as it is commonly used for copying natural systems.
